Running data includes metrics such as Training Effect, which measures the impact of an activity on your aerobic and anaerobic fitness, and Running Dynamics, so cadence and stride length, while for cycling youll get information on things like Power Output (when connected to a power meter) and Respiration Rate. So if someone gives you a set of coordinates to route to, you can input that into the unit and get direct routing to that location: Note that Instinct 2 Series supports basically every coordinate type known to mankind, in fact, you can find the massive list here.
